ASACP CEO Honored By The Redondo Beach Round Table Beautification Committee

Los Angeles, CA (April 1, 2010) - Association of Sites Advocating Child Protection (ASACP) CEO, Joan Irvine, a graduate of the Chamber of Commerce Leadership Redondo Beach Program, was recently honored by the Redondo Beach Round Table Beautification Committee.

The Redondo Beach Round Table is a public education and advisory group comprised of City Leaders, elected officials, and a cross section of community leaders representing as many interests in the City as possible. Since 1962, the Round Table format has stimulated discussion and action on many topics across the city, including the environment, social issues and economic planning.

The Beautification Committee was established for the purpose of recognizing residents and businesses within the City who have remodeled, re-landscaped, or have newly built a building with especially noteworthy design and construction. The Beautification Award was recently given to Irvine and the Leadership Redondo Class of 2008 for their Get Water Smart Garden project at Wilderness Park.

Since there is a water crisis in California and Redondo Beach has the additional problem of water run-off into the ocean, Leadership Redondo 2008 (LR08) chose to plant an educational Get Water Smart Garden in Wilderness Park (http://www.getwatersmart-rb.org) as their group project.

Joan Irvine started with ASACP in 2002 as Executive Director and was promoted to CEO in 2008. She has worked in business technology and association management for over 25 years for companies including ADP, SDC and VIC. She advocates on behalf of online child protection in Washington and Sacramento, and participates in the Financial Coalition Against Child Pornography, Family Online Safety Institute, and the Congressional Internet Caucus Advisory Committee. She belongs to the American Society of Association Executives (ASAE) and is a graduate of the Redondo Beach Chamber of Commerce Leadership program. She has a BA in Human Development and Psychology from the University of Kansas. Irvine is a graduate of the Leadership Redondo Class of 2008. Leadership Redondo is a program of the Redondo Beach Chamber of Commerce and Visitors Bureau.

Founded in 1996, the Association of Sites Advocating Child Protection (ASACP) is a non-profit organization dedicated to eliminating child pornography from the Internet. ASACP also works to help parents prevent children from viewing age-restricted material online with its Restricted To Adults – RTA Website Label.
